This would make government shutdowns over budgets a thing of the past, forcing both parties’ leadership to aggressively seek timely passage of appropriations bills under regular order to achieve funding and policy objectives. It'd be a strong incentive for constructive compromise involving a majority of Congress.
Funding the federal government at the previously-enacted level without regard for changing policy needs or individual programs’ value wastes taxpayer dollars by ignoring hundreds of hours of consideration and program evaluation incorporated into each federal agency’s budget submission.
